About the Role

We are looking for an enthusiastic and experienced Level 3 EYFS Teaching Assistant to join a supportive and dedicated team within a specialist SEND school in Gateshead. This is an excellent opportunity to make a real difference in the lives of children and young people with a range of special educational needs.

As a Teaching Assistant, you will work closely with class teachers and other support staff to provide tailored support that helps pupils access learning, develop independence, and achieve their potential.

Key Responsibilities
  • Supporting pupils with a range of SEND needs (including ASD, ADHD, SEMH, MLD, and complex needs)
  • Assisting the class teacher with lesson delivery and classroom management
  • Providing 1:1 and small group interventions when required
  • Promoting positive behaviour and emotional well-being
  • Contributing to a safe, nurturing, and inclusive learning environment
  • Supporting with personal care needs
Requirements
  • Level 3 Teaching Assistant qualification (or equivalent)
  • Previous experience working in an SEND setting is highly desirable
  • A caring, patient, and resilient approach
  • Good communication and teamwork skills
  • An enhanced DBS on the update service (or willingness to apply for one)
